My Faith during Lock Down

by Tom Davison

Contentment …

 I am a fortunate and blessed man. I have really benefitted from the slower pace of life put upon each of us during lockdown. I haven’t been able to give any Maths tutorials since March 23rd – so my calculator and Tables Book have been put away til September. Hopefully, I won’t have forgotten how to do “my sums” by then! But as a self-employed person, I have been eligible for the weekly COVID-payment. Heather has continued to work and so all our needs have been met.

Ben, Emma, and Heather were all working from home until recent weeks, when each of their respective academic years ended. We were blessed to have enough space in our home for each of them to have a workstation and not right on top of each other. Plus, the internet connection behaved itself, most of the time!

It was great to have each other’s company over mealtimes, local walks, and movie nights. Additionally, I was very pleased to look after the home and be the “hunter/gatherer” making the weekly perilous trip around Dunnes! It provided me with the additional social interaction this extrovert needs … a chance to chat (& listen) to “random-ers”!! 

The dry, sunny weather has been magnificent. Early mornings have been a particular treat – sitting in our back garden listening to the birdsong, sun on my face, reading my Bible and chatting to God. What a blessing!

By temperament I am always “on the go” ~ whether physically or allowing my mind to be consumed with far too many thoughts and matters to ponder. I’m not very good at resting. So, what a joy it has been for me to be reminded by our Father, “Be still, and know that I am God. Further He declares in Isaiah 55:8, “For my thoughts are not your thoughts, neither are your ways my ways.”

So, whilst this period has been exceedingly difficult for many people right across the world, I don’t deny that – yet I have peace in the core of my being that God can be trusted. He knows what He is doing. Therefore, as I go about each day – whether cooking, running, gardening, queueing for groceries, I am content and grateful. God is with me.

He promises us in Jeremiah 29:13,

“You will seek me and find me when you seek me with all your heart.”

My Faith during Lock Down

by Jenny Leahy

One of the stand out moments for me during lock down was Easter Sunday.  A day when Christians all over the world celebrate the resurrection of Jesus.  I remember waking up on Easter Sunday with a real sense of sadness.  I was sitting on my bed looking out the window at the green and thinking about the enormity of this pandemic and the scale of the destruction it was causing.  Imagine something attacking the entire human race and literally stopping worldwide Easter celebrations … frightening!

A few days later during one of my many ‘lock down walks’ in Newbridge Park, I looked around in wonder at all that nature was achieving despite this pandemic.  I had a real sense of God’s promise and love for us and a deep sense of peace that God was with us and bigger than this virus and that there was no need to feel fear.  While people the world over were locked in their homes and daily life had come to a standstill nature was still thriving. One of the good news stories during this lockdown was the wonder and joy that people all over the world were experiencing in relation to nature.  I kept thinking of Genesis 9, 16:

“When I see the rainbow in the clouds, I will remember the eternal covenant between God and every living creature on earth.”

 

Not being able to worship on Sunday mornings together as a Church family has been really tough.  I am so thankful to Andy, Josh, Kathryn and Scott for the amazing work they have done to bring worship into our homes.  Mum’s In Prayer has also been a huge blessing to me during these last few weeks.  We pray every Tuesday for our children and their teachers and schools. Despite the fact that schools have been closed we have continued to pray via zoom and have had so many answers to prayer for our children. 

I think in times of uncertainty when we feel under attack and helpless it is amazing to remember how powerful and unchanging God’s love for us is.

 

“There is no one like the God of Israel. He rides across the heavens to help you, across the skies in majestic splendour.”  Deuteronomy 33, 26
